Consider the system of equations.

5x + 2y = 12

5x – 2y = 28

What is the solution to the system of equations?

A.
(5, -6.5)

B.
(4, 16)

C.
(4, -4)

D.
(-4, 4)

Answer:

C

Step-by-step explanation:

5x + 2y = 12 --(1)

5x - 2y = 28 --(2)

(2) - (1):

5x - 2y - 5x - 2y = 28 - 12

-4y = 16

y = -4

when y = -4, x = 4
